- The distance between North Battleford, Sk, Canada and El Carano, Colombia is approximately 5,972 km or 3,711 mi.
- To reach North Battleford, Sk in this distance one would set out from El Carano bearing 336.8°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ach North Battleford, Sk bearing 319.6° or NW .
- North Battleford, Sk has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as El Carano has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- North Battleford, Sk is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as El Carano is in or near the subtropical rain for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 24.5 °C (44.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 34.6 °C (62.3°F) more in North Battleford, Sk.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 7541.6 mm (296.9 in) less which is equivalent to 7541.6 l/m² (185.09 US gal/ft²) or 75,416,000 l/ha (8,062,471 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 37.1° lower in North Battleford, Sk than in El Carano.
